    Courtship, (sculpture).
    Artist: 
    Mitchell, Henry, 1915-1980, sculptor.
    Title: 
    Courtship, (sculpture).
    Other Titles: 
    Henry M. Phillips Memorial Fountain, (sculpture).
    Dates: 
    1958. Cast ca. 1958.
    Medium: 
    Bronze.
    Dimensions: 
    Fountain: approx. H. 30 in. Diam. 120 in.
    Inscription: 
    PHILLIPS FOUNTAIN ERECTED WITH FUNDS BEQUEATHED FOR ITS CONSTRUCTION AND MAINTENANCE BY HENRY M. PHILLIPS WHO WAS APPOINTED A MEMBER OF THE FAIRMOUNT PARK COMMISSION UPON ITS CREATION IN 1867 AND SERVED AS ITS PRESIDENT FROM 1881 UNTIL HIS DEATH IN 1884
    Description: 
    An eight-sided bronze relief installed in the center of a large circular fountain basin. The eight reliefs depict horses running and interacting. Water jets out of the center of the eight-sided relief. An inscription appears around the rim of the fountain basin.
